Intended Use
- 1-12 lead electrocardiograph capable of recording and transmitting standard ECGs for . the purpose of cardiac monitoring and diagnosis; the system incorporates recording/ transmitting circuitry, a package of firmware and software, and is intended for use by a medical professional
- . The ECG can be recorded and transmitted to a local or remote receiving station for consultation with a medical professional
- The ECG can be recorded and transmitted to a local or remote hand-held device or a . Personal Computer or a printer for viewing and processing
- . Allows patients at remote locations to display and transmit their ECG data to medical professionals via a communication device to a remote server
- . Intended for self-testing by patients and by healtheare professionals at home and in medical settings
Device Description
Pelex-04 wireless electrocardiograph with software accessories (Personal Heart Expert software, Pelex Server&Database software, and Pelex Explorer software)
